Sustainable land management (SLM)-focusing on soil health, ecosystem and biodiversity preservation, resilience to natural hazards, and landscape remediation-is a critical priority for modern societies. Life on earth relies on healthy land systems for food, clean water, biodiversity, economic stability, and overall well-being. However, land is under growing pressure from climate change and human activities such as industrialization, urbanization, and unsustainable farming, leading to desertification, degradation, and pollution. According to the European Commission's Joint Research Centre, 60-70% of soils in the EU are unhealthy. Globally, land degradation and climate change may displace up to 700 million people by 2050. In response, global and European initiatives are increasingly linked to land preservation and restoration. The "One Health" approach connects soil health with ecosystem stability, food systems, and human health. Land and its ecosystem services are central to many UN Sustainable Development Goals (e.g., SDG2, SDG3, SDG6, and SDG15). In the EU, land is central to the green and digital transition, integrated into key strategies: Farm to Fork, Biodiversity 2030, Climate Adaptation, Zero Pollution, Forest and Organic Strategies, and the upcoming Soil Strategy and Circular Economy Action Plan. This Special Issue aspires to be a key reference in the field, highlighting innovative methods, case studies, and reviews across the broad spectrum of integrated land and environmental management.
